What is Biogas Production Volume?
The volume of biogas generated from the anaerobic digestion of organic waste, which can be used as a renewable energy source.
What is the standard formula?
Total Cubic Meters (or other units) of Biogas Produced

What factors influence biogas production volume?
Feedstock quality, digester design, and operational practices all significantly impact biogas production volume. Variations in these factors can lead to fluctuations in output, necessitating close monitoring.
How can I improve biogas production efficiency?
Improving feedstock management and optimizing digester conditions are key strategies. Regular maintenance and staff training also play crucial roles in enhancing overall efficiency.
What are the benefits of tracking biogas production volume?
Tracking this KPI allows organizations to identify trends, optimize processes, and make informed decisions. It also aids in benchmarking against industry standards to ensure competitive performance.
How often should biogas production be monitored?
Daily monitoring is recommended to capture fluctuations and respond quickly to any issues. Weekly reviews can help identify longer-term trends and inform strategic decisions.
